Re: SHOOTING RANGE LOCATIONS AND EVALUATIONS
Hi all,
Prado is a nice range and they have shotgun and pistol ranges. They also have IDPA shoots.
Raahauge's in Norco is a nice range and they have many activities, check their website. They have trap and skeet open to the public. There are IPSC shoots every Sat open to the public. I am a member so I can go to the pistol range 7 day a week. There is also a rifle area, again for members.
I use to belong to west end, but to much in the way of politics. The rifle and pistol range is usually open to the public on weekends. The other ranges are for members only including the 600 yard range. They have many different shoots on the weekends that are open to the public. I think they have a website.
There is a good range in Redlands. I think it is called the fish and game shooting range. They have ranges open to the public. They have a very good rifle range. You should check with them before going out as it is a members range as well and sometimes they have activities.
I use to shoot at a range in 29 palms, but I don't know if it is still open. I also shot at the Palm Springs gun club, but I hear they may try to shut it down.
There is an indoor range in Riverside called the Magnum indoor range on Sampson. It is OK if one wants to shoot indoors and they limit the type of ammo you can use.
We also have a shooting range on Catalina Island, Members only. Once in a while we do have an IPSC or steel match which is open to the public, but after the fire I don't foresee anything soon.
Regards, SSC
